Photochlor

Description:
Photochlor, with the CAS number 149402-51-7, is a chemical compound that is primarily known for its application in photodynamic therapy (PDT), particularly in the treatment of certain types of cancers. It is a photosensitizer, meaning it can absorb light and subsequently produce reactive oxygen species when exposed to specific wavelengths of light. This property allows it to selectively target and destroy malignant cells while minimizing damage to surrounding healthy tissue. Photochlor is characterized by its ability to localize in tumor tissues, enhancing its therapeutic efficacy. Additionally, it is typically administered in conjunction with light exposure to activate its therapeutic effects. The compound is often evaluated for its stability, solubility, and absorption characteristics, which are crucial for its effectiveness in clinical applications. As with many chemical substances, safety and toxicity profiles are also important considerations in its use, necessitating thorough research and clinical trials to establish optimal dosages and treatment protocols.
